DK Recruitment Ltd is seeking an Ocean Freight Pricing Specialist for its client based in Hounslow, UK. This full-time position offers a salary of £45,000. The ideal candidate will have proven experience in ocean freight pricing, strong analytical skills, and proficiency in Excel for market analysis.
Responsibilities include:
- Negotiating container rates with shipping lines
- Managing customer quotes and tenders for freight forwarders
